5 month update

Its been 5 months since my surgery. I did have some bumps at about 2 months. I devolped necrosis of my belly button and a small area of my incision above my private area. Its all healed up and I actually just had me revision for my scar, and to remove the fat necrosis that devolped underneath, and also for my belly button. It was dome in the operating room with a local, I did pretty good. The worst pain I felt was from the needles. The fat necrosis was really deep but he got it out and straighten out my incision. Let me say that it hurt later that evening and Im still in a little pain. It feels like I got a tummy tuck again but a little less painful. I do want to say that my Doctor and his staff are awesome!!
